TFGM Virtual Power Purchase Agreement (vPPA)

Transport for Greater Manchester (‘TfGM’) is seeking to enter into a virtual Power Purchase Agreement (‘vPPA’) with a supplier (‘the Supplier’) to meet its clean energy goals​, and reduce price volatility risk from its energy portfolio. TfGM has a clear set of objectives for the vPPA procurement and is looking to engage with interested developers​ who can meet the following requirements: * Power generation to meet demand of between 35 and 42 GWh annually. * Delivery of a vPPA with a target Commerical Operations Date (COD) no later than 30 June 2029. * A ‘pay-as-produced’ vPPA contract structure, for the supply of wind power (onshore or offshore) or solar power. * A vPPA term of 15 years, with the option, at TFGM’s discretion, to extend for a further 5 years. TfGM is the local government body responsible for transport across Greater Manchester, delivering an integrated transport network (known as the Bee Network) to improve lives by connecting people and places. We’re the proud owners of Metrolink (the UK’s largest light rail network) and we’re looking to expand it in future. We’ve taken bus services back under local control: we’re the first city region outside London to franchise bus services, and have committed to greening our network through zero emission vehicles. Local bus services moved under local control as part of the Bee Network by January 2025, and we’re working to bring local rail services onto the Bee Network by 2030. In addition to our Head Office in central Manchester, we own Greater Manchester’s major bus depots and bus stations, stops and shelters, invest in and manage new, modern transport interchanges, and manage a range of electric vehicle charging infrastructure across our estate, and more widely across Greater Manchester. Based on this, we therefore have a large energy portfolio, and are looking at interventions to manage this effectively and efficiently.
